About the role

The Employee Relations Manager supports the Labor & Employment and Human Resources teams to investigate and resolve employee relations concerns and allegations of misconduct or policy violations. This role identifies issues, develops investigation strategies, conducts witness interviews, and proposes practical resolutions. Additionally, the position assists in enterprise-wide HR policy development, updates, and training initiatives. The role is hybrid, with remote work on Mondays and Fridays and in-office work Tuesday through Thursday at IDEX’s corporate headquarters in Northbrook, Illinois. Periodic travel to IDEX business units is required.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ct prompt, thorough, and objective investigations into employee relations complaints, allegations of misconduct, and suspected policy violations from intake to completion, including:
    • Developing investigation plans for concerns raised through various channels.
    • Independently conducting witness interviews.
    • Partnering with business units and departments to gather and review relevant facts and evidence.
    • Preparing comprehensive investigative reports for internal stakeholders.
    • Performing investigative responsibilities in accordance with Company procedures.
  • Identify patterns and root causes contributing to concerns or obstacles to a positive employee experience.
  • Collaborate with Legal and HR stakeholders to proactively respond to legal and employee relations developments and implement solutions.
  • Develop and maintain effective case management resources and processes to identify and report internal trends.
  • Advise key stakeholders and leaders on complex scenarios involving policy and misconduct violations, partnering on recommended outcomes and resolutions.
  • Build productive working relationships across functions, levels, and teams to achieve shared objectives.
  • Ensure policies and programs are consistently administered in compliance with Company policies and applicable laws.
  • Track and understand legal and HR developments, emerging risks, and best practices with the Labor & Employment team.
  • Develop templates, resources, and toolkits to assist HR in managing legal developments.
  • Partner with Labor & Employment and HR to develop and facilitate relevant training and resources.
  • Collaborate to implement and modify applicable policies.
